When you file Chapter seven bankruptcy, which is the most typical sort of buyer bankruptcy, it is going to stay on your credit report for a decade from your filing day. But when you file Chapter 13 bankruptcy, the adverse mark will fall off your credit report 7 decades after the filing day.

No matter if you file Chapter 7 or Chapter 13, an account which was in no way late after which A part of bankruptcy are going to be eradicated 7 decades from your bankruptcy filing day. When the account was delinquent at some time it had been A part of the bankruptcy, It will probably be taken out seven many years from the initial delinquency day within the account.

When the creditor writes off your financial debt subsequent nonpayment, this is referred to as a cost-off. Cost-offs continue being on your credit report for 7 many years additionally 180 days with the day the charge-off was reported to your credit company.

In many conditions, debtors can hold their automobiles and houses, supplied There exists not excess equity above governing exemption rules. The Chapter seven Trustee is entitled to get possession and possession of every one of the debtor’s house that is “non-exempt.” Non-exempt residence contains all assets of your debtor that cannot be claimed as exempt beneath governing exemption law.
